Civil and Architectural Engineering at KTH
This master's programme gives you advanced knowledge in the field of Structural Engineering as well as in the subjects of Civil or Architectural Engineering. You learn how to implement this knowledge by comprehensively understanding buildings and infrastructure as advanced technical systems. The programme offers advanced-level courses that often relate to real-life projects and the use of state-of-the-art tools for design and modelling.
The programme offers two main tracks: Civil Engineering and Architectural Engineering. The Civil Engineering track is devoted to techniques for the design, construction and maintenance of roads, streets, railway tracks, bridges and tunnels. The Architectural Engineering track focuses on engineering design and analysis of buildings with an emphasis on system-level performance from a lifecycle perspective. The teaching methods comprise a mix of lectures, exercises, projects and laboratory work. During the programme, students interact with industry in various ways, including project work in collaboration with industry experts and the involvement of industry experts as teachers.
The programme ends with a degree project relating to an issue within the field, focusing on investigating and analysing a problem. The project is an opportunity for you to interact with both industry and current research.
This is a two-year programme, 120 ECTS credits, in English. Graduates will be awarded a Master of Science degree. The programme is given at the KTH Campus in Stockholm by the School of Architecture and Built Environment (at KTH).
The programme courses cover topics such as the design and construction of roads, streets, railway tracks, bridges, and tunnels, foundation engineering, geotechnical engineering, hydraulic engineering, structural engineering, concrete structures, steel and timber structures, building materials, indoor climate and energy, and environmental aspects of the built environment.

Deferment of student loans in the United States
KTH is an accredited institution at the US Department of Education and holds a Title IV 'Deferment Only' status (OPE ID 03274300). US students may defer payments on existing federal student loan accounts while enrolled in a master’s programme at KTH. The 'Deferment Only' status does not allow students to take out federal student loans for enrollment at KTH. However, the accreditation facilitates grant and loan opportunities for US students, as many private student loan institutions in the US use this designation as a requirement to grant new loans. Students who wish to defer payments must contact their lending institution in the US.
The building sector has a long-term impact on the built environment, and the master's programme in Civil and Architectural Engineering meets a well-known need for engineers who possess the knowledge and skills to design and build infrastructure, residential housing and workplaces using optimal technology in terms of economy and environmental impact. The programme equips graduates with the globally required skills and excellent future career possibilities in research and industry, nationally and internationally.
Graduates from the programme can pursue a professional career designing buildings and infrastructure such as roads, railways, tunnels and bridges. Graduates often work as designers or project leaders in the construction industry, at consultancy firms, for municipalities or public authorities such as the road or rail administration. You can expect to take on roles such as constructor, designer, project developer, structural engineer, VVS and energy system, production engineer, project manager, design manager or researcher. Graduates from the programme work at companies and organisations such as Skanska, NCC, AFRY, PEAB, JM, Veidekke, Svevia, WSP and Trafikverket (Swedish Transport Administration). Furthermore, graduates can pursue academic research careers and doctoral studies. As a result of our cooperation with the industry, particularly during the master's degree project work and other projects, students have the opportunity to meet people from the industry first-hand, which often leads to job opportunities.
